FujiFilm JZ500 vs Sony S930 Overview
Below is a complete analysis of the FujiFilm JZ500 vs Sony S930, both Small Sensor Compact cameras by brands FujiFilm and Sony. There exists a significant gap among the resolutions of the JZ500 (14MP) and S930 (10MP) but they enjoy the same exact sensor sizing (1/2.3").

The JZ500 was announced 18 months later than the S930 making the cameras a generation apart from one another. Both of the cameras offer the identical body type (Compact).

FujiFilm JZ500 vs Sony S930 Physical Comparison
In case you're intending to lug around your camera, you will have to take into account its weight and proportions. The FujiFilm JZ500 has got physical dimensions of 97mm x 57mm x 29m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 1.1") and a weight of 168 grams (0.37 lbs) whilst the Sony S930 has measurements of 90mm x 61mm x 26mm (3.5" x 2.4" x 1.0") and a weight of 167 grams (0.37 lbs).

FujiFilm JZ500 vs Sony S930 Sensor Comparison
More often than not, it is very tough to imagine the gap in sensor measurements purely by looking through a spec sheet. The graphic below may offer you a greater sense of the sensor sizes in the JZ500 and S930.
As you can see, both of the cameras offer the same exact sensor sizing but different megapixels. You should expect to see the FujiFilm JZ500 to render more detail with its extra 4MP. Greater resolution will also let you crop pics a little more aggressively. The more recent JZ500 should have an advantage in sensor tech.
